Broad lavender pink petals with a soft white centre. An eye catching choice that even has colourful buds. ‘Tabledance’ is an Oriental x Trumpet lily or O.T. Hybrid.
It is easy to create an indulgent display of colour with O.T. Liliums. They are gorgeous in the garden and perfect for cut flowers too.
These Lilies add glamour and fragrance to the garden. These lilies are also tough, and able to withstand our hot summers. They are best planted in a permanent position where, as they establish they will become more and more floriferous.
It is a good idea to fertilise your O.T. Lilies, they are hungry bulbs and this will give you the best blooms. Adding an organic fertiliser when you first see growth, then again as they are fading is ideal. If you are growing your Lilies in pots, fertiliser is even more important and in this case a slow release pellet such as Thrive or a liquid fertiliser. Water to establish, and keep moist in active growth for best results.
In warmer climates, it is a good idea to grow your O.T. Liliums in part shade or morning sun, then your flowers will last longer.
